Also here's the lore for you all. In our world, the majority of the communist revolutions in Europe either failed, or never even occurred in the first place. Well what if that was changed? What if the Spartacist Uprising had succeeded in Germany, leading to European socialism? Well, first of all we'll have to assume Germany is in a bit of a different spot, likely receiving aid from the Bolsheviks in order to hopefully secure a relatively swift victory over the already fragile Germany. First of all, after the Spartacist victory the French would likely march into the Rhineland to prevent further communist expansion into Europe. The French promise that this is only temporary, however after they annex the Saarland and install a French puppet in the Rhine, it becomes clear the French don't intend on leaving anytime soon. After this, the Spartacists along with the Bolsheviks send aid to the Hungarian Soviet Republic who were fighting the Hungarian-Romanian war as well as the Hungarian-Czechoslovak war at the time. With the help of the Germans and Bolsheviks they are able to push back the Romanians and force a favorable peace, as well as establishing an independent Slovak Soviet Republic, something which they did in real life. After this, the Polish Soviet war breaks out still, however in this timeline with help from both the Germans and some aid from the Hungarians, the Communists are able to win against the Poles. Germany then takes back the territory that the Poles managed to take after WWI and they manage to convince the Bolsheviks to establish an independent Polish Socialist state. From 1919-1920 in Italy, there was a period known as the "two red years" which was comprised of much social conflict between mainly leftist and more right wing, even fascist movements. In our time there was a good chance that the Italian socialists would revolt possibly leading to a civil war or just a socialist Italy, however the orders to revolt were never given and so no revolt took place. In this timeline however, the orders would be given and with the help of mainly Germany and the Soviets, Italy would manage to install a socialist government. While this is going on, Germany annexes Austria with much support in Austria, although to the discontent of the west, mainly France. A few years later, in 1925, the Comintern begins their plan to invade and "liberate" the Balkans. This operation is known as Operation Danubia. The Germans and Hungarians invade from the north into Yugoslavia while the Romanians and Italians push from the south into Bulgaria and Albania. The operation is still ongoing but it has shown much success so far and is sure to continue in the following months.
